We were among the first people to explore a site in Gravesend. It took us some time to find the entrance, and for the first time in my life, I felt scared going through an opening because I thought I might get stuck. However, the entrance was intriguing. Once we were inside, the tunnels were quite clean and appeared to be largely untouched. It was nice to see such a well-maintained shelter.

During the war, the site was refurbished in 1939, and an air-raid shelter was added in Cliffe. German bombers targeted this company primarily due to the power cables and switchgear it manufactured..
